Benefits

For the period spent at the University of St Andrews, the scholarships will comprise a full tuition fee award and an annual stipend paid at a rate set by the University of St Andrews. For 2025-2026, the stipend is £19,775 p.a., with an annual uplift published by the University each academic year.

Your application should include the following:

Statement why you are the right candidate for the project (max. 1 page);

CV, including a list of publications;

Scanned academic degrees;

At least two references.
